RTX A4000
RTX A4000 has 16 GB of VRAM at 448 GB/s — about 14.88 GiB usable after driver and compositor overhead. 1670 of 2118 indexed models fit at 128K context with q4_0 KV.

Speed is modeled, not measured: decode is memory-bandwidth bound, so tokens per second is bytes read per token against achievable bandwidth. Mixture-of-experts models carry a wider band because only the routed experts are read each step, and few have been measured publicly.

- How much usable memory does a RTX A4000 actually have?
- Its nameplate is 16 GB, but about 14.88 GiB is available to a model once driver and compositor overhead is accounted for.
- Is a RTX A4000 fast for local AI?
- Its memory bandwidth is 448 GB/s, and that figure — not teraflops — is what governs token generation speed. Capacity decides what you can run; bandwidth decides how fast it runs.
